Transaction 7e885f405cabcd34ec777f2a843b06189998567db2d889f1f2b4ae8149ebe0fa

2 Input
1 Outputs
  • 7e885f405cabcd34ec777f2a843b06189998567db2d889f1f2b4ae8149ebe0fa:0
  • value  13000000
    address  1P6mqQ8ZFPUE491UwicsW9FWD1xeEz3aS3